AMPH trades at $18.72, down 1.58% with bearish technical signals despite oversold RSI readings. The company reported mixed Q1 2026 results with EPS of $0.42 missing estimates of $0.70, continuing a trend of recent earnings disappointments. Valuation metrics appear reasonable with P/E of 11.29 and P/B of 1.07, while profitability remains solid with 47.34% gross margins. Recent news includes a Zacks Strong Sell rating and ongoing securities law investigation.
The stock faces near-term headwinds from earnings misses and negative analyst sentiment, though current valuations provide some downside protection. Upside potential exists if the company can execute its strategic pivot to proprietary drugs and biosimilars while managing BAQSIMI discount pressures. Key risks include ongoing legal scrutiny and competitive pressures in the generic drug market.
Shopify (SHOP) trades at $122.54, down 0.51% on the day, with a bullish technical outlook supported by moving averages and a consensus analyst price target of $149.18. Revenue grew to $11.56 billion in 2025, with net income of $1.23 billion, though valuation ratios like P/E of 120.14 remain elevated. Recent news highlights Bank of America reinstating coverage with a Buy rating and $150 target, citing AI-driven commerce growth potential.
The stock offers upside potential from strong revenue growth and AI adoption, but risks include high valuation sensitivity and tech sector volatility. Analyst sentiment is overwhelmingly positive with 65% Buy ratings, but investors should monitor execution against earnings expectations, especially with Q2 2026 results due August 5, 2026.
